A larger population density always indicates a larger population size.

Answers

Answer 1
Answer: This is only true per square mile or square kilometer, but it's false generally (so I would say that the statement is false).

 For example, Hong Kong and Macau have by far higher population density (with Macau said to have the biggest population density in the world) than mainland China, but Mainland China has a larger population.

A fallacy in logic stating that "after this, therefore because of this" is called _____.

Answers

The answer is post hoc. This is a logical fallacy that states "after this, therefore because of this." This fallacy is used when one is coming to a conclusion based on an order of events rather than using other factors that might lead to other interpretations.
